Bruce Willis' wife has opened up about the emotional challenges they are facing due to his struggle with dementia. She emphasizes the importance of finding moments of beauty and positivity amidst the difficulties.
In a heartfelt message, Bruce Willis' wife expressed how important it is for care partners to share uplifting moments and photos. She acknowledged that while her public appearances might suggest she's living her best life, the reality is different. She disclosed the effort it takes to remain positive every day, both for herself, their two children, and for Bruce Willis. She clarified that her outward appearance might be misleading, as she's currently not in a good place emotionally due to the challenges they are confronting.
Amidst the struggles they face, Bruce Willis' wife encourages everyone to find moments of beauty and respite in their lives, even during challenging times.
